As the premier conference for interdisciplinary rehabilitation research, the ACRM Annual Conference offers the opportunity to earn Continuing Education (CE) contact hours in your choice of 14 disciplines. Accordingly, your presentation must be reviewed for compliance with CE requirements. The presentation file will be reviewed to verify that:
1. All required CE Compliance Slides are included
2. The content is suitable for our interdisciplinary audience
3. The presentation is free of commercial content
4. The presentation generally matches up with the learning objectives for the session
